NBA Comparison: Malik Rose

Aran Smith – 12/14/2005

Strengths: Very talented offensive player with the ability to play back to the basket or face up … Explosive leaping ability despite the knee injuries … Has great quickness, and crafty at getting around defenders to the basket … Has a nose for the basket … Very competitive and talented player, a real difference maker on the college level … Ball handling is very good for a big forward … Shooting ability out to 18 feet is good … Has great upper body strength … Super long arms and big hands make him like a magnet grabbing loose balls … Great motor, competes hard …

Weaknesses: Injuries to his knees have required two major reconstructive surgeries. The fear of another knee injury is there, so proving he can remain healthy through his Junior year would help his chances of getting drafted in the first round … He’s undersized to play power forward in the NBA, but has good athleticism and long arms … Has good speed, but looks very awkward running the court, his back is always upright, he never leans forward, and his legs don’t extend fully … Lacks the passing ability and perimeter skills to play small forward …

Notes: Led the Pac-Ten in rebounding as a freshman, two years ago. Came into Cal rated as one of the top 5 prospects in the country.
